Kollmorgen BDS5A-220-00010-606A-2-031 - Servo Drive

The Kollmorgen BDS5A-220-00010-606A-2-031 stands out as a high-performance drive solution engineered for demanding applications across the power industry, petrochemical, and general automation sectors. Built with precision and robustness in mind, this model delivers exceptional input/output capacity and reliability, making it an indispensable component in complex industrial environments. At its core, the Kollmorgen BDS5A-220-00010-606A-2-031 features a high-efficiency power rating capable of handling substantial loads with remarkable stability. Designed to sustain continuous operation under rigorous conditions, it offers an input voltage range tailored for high-power drives, ensuring compatibility with a wide range of industrial power supplies. Its output capability supports precise torque control and rapid dynamic responses, which are critical in applications such as turbine control in the power industry or complex mixing processes in petrochemical plants.


The drive’s advanced thermal management and rugged construction enhance durability, enabling it to withstand harsh environments, vibration, and temperature extremes without compromising performance. In real-world scenarios, the application of the BDS5A-220-00010-606A-2-031 in the power industry is particularly noteworthy. It excels in regulating motors that operate cooling systems, pumps, and compressors, ensuring energy efficiency and process stability. Within the petrochemical sector, this drive provides the precise motor control necessary for reactors, extruders, and conveyor systems, where variable speed and torque accuracy are paramount. Additionally, in general automation, the BDS5A-220-00010-606A-2-031 integrates seamlessly with automated assembly lines, robotic arms, and packaging machines, delivering the responsiveness and reliability required to maintain production uptime and product quality. When compared to other Kollmorgen models, the BDS5A-220-00010-606A-2-031 offers a unique balance of power density and configurability.


For instance, while the Kollmorgen BDS4A-210J-0001-WO is designed for lower power applications with a more compact footprint, the BDS5A model scales up the input/output capacity, making it suitable for heavier industrial tasks. Similarly, although the Kollmorgen AKD-P00306-NBAN-0000 drive series is well-regarded for its servo drive capabilities, the BDS5A excels in handling larger, more demanding loads typical in power and petrochemical industries. This differentiator allows facilities to choose the BDS5A-220-00010-606A-2-031 when reliability and endurance under heavy duty are non-negotiable.
